circumcentre method

Coordinate circumcentre()

Computes the circumcentre of this triangle. The circumcentre is the centre of the circumcircle, the smallest circle which encloses the triangle. It is also the common intersection point of the perpendicular bisectors of the sides of the triangle, and is the only point which has equal distance to all three vertices of the triangle.

The circumcentre does not necessarily lie within the triangle.

This method uses an algorithm due to J.R.Shewchuk which uses normalization to the origin to improve the accuracy of computation. (See Lecture Notes on Geometric Robustness, Jonathan Richard Shewchuk, 1999).

@return the circumcentre of this triangle
